Texas Biodesign Workshop
Presented by the Texas Innovation Center, MD Anderson Cancer Center, and Brumley Institute for Graduate Entrepreneurship, Texas Biodesign brings together scientists, engineers, clinicians, and business leaders to apply needs-driven innovation inspired by biological processes. Participants learn to identify, evaluate, and develop impactful solutions to medical and business challenges.

About the Workshop

This hands-on program introduces the Stanford Biodesign methodology, a framework originally developed for medical technologies and now applied across industries—from software to consumer products.

Participants will:

  • Assess multiple needs
  • Select a lead concept
  • Present a value proposition for potential advancement

 

EnergizeUT
The Brumley Institute for Graduate Entrepreneurship partnership with the Energy Institute has created valuable opportunities for students pursuing innovation in the energy technology sector and seeking to bring their ideas and products to market. In addition to the Energy Ventures Practicum course, which has been offered since 2023, the two institutes jointly host the annual EnergizeUT event. Recognized as The University of Texas at Austin’s premier energy innovation showcase, EnergizeUT brings together students, industry leaders, and entrepreneurs to explore the future of energy. Discovery to Impact
In a joint effort to empower innovative and technically savvy students with applicable business knowledge, Discovery to Impact and Brumley Institute are delivering co-curricular workshop sessions such as Business for STEM and Intro to Commercialization.
